A boundary Schwarz lemma for mappings from the unit polydisc to irreducible bounded symmetric domains
Mathematische Nachrichten ( IF 0.8 ) Pub Date : 2020-05-07 , DOI: 10.1002/mana.201900493
Hidetaka Hamada 1 , Gabriela Kohr 2
Affiliation  

In this paper, we obtain a boundary Schwarz lemma for C1 (pluriharmonic, holomorphic) mappings from the unit polydisc Un in Cn to irreducible bounded symmetric domains realized as the unit ball BX of an N‐dimensional simple JB*‐triple X. In particular, we obtain a version of the boundary Schwarz lemma for C1 (pluriharmonic, holomorphic) mappings from Un into the Euclidean unit ball BN in CN. These results are generalizations of recent results regarding boundary Schwarz lemma in higher dimensions.
